Foresters Financial is very pleased to announce the appointment of two new Board Members, David Heath and Caroline Banhidy. They both bring a wealth of experience in two different areas of expertise and we want to welcome them to the new look Foresters Financial.


David Heath


David has over 25 years’ experience in actuarial consulting. He has experience across all areas of actuarial practice, specialising in general insurance and accident compensation. He has been a Director and Actuary with Cumpston Sarjeant Pty Ltd since 2007.

Currently, he is a Board member of the Transport Accident Commission (TAC) and Chair of the TAC’s Audit Committee. David is also a volunteer Board member and Honorary Treasurer of the Australian Association of Gerontology.

David is a Fellow at the Institute of Actuaries of Australia (FIAA), CPA Australia (FCPA), and the Financial Services Institute of Australasia (F Fin). He is also a graduate member of the Australian Institute of Company Directors (GAICD).

He holds a Bachelor of Economics (Hons.) from Monash University, a Graduate Diploma of Applied Finance from the Securities Institute of Australia (now FINSIA), and graduate Certificate of Business Forensics from the University of Melbourne.

David has been heavily involved in the education of the next generation of actuaries and lectures post-graduate students in actuarial studies at the University of Melbourne, where he is also an Honorary Senior Fellow.


Caroline Banhidy


Caroline Banhidy has over 30 years’ experience in financial services with a focus on investment governance and management. She is an experienced consultant in strategy, performance improvement, governance and value realisation capabilities and director of a number of organisations.

She has both strategic acumen and operational expertise working to effect transformational change across businesses. With a variety of expertise within the financial and professional services, membership organisations, investment management, superannuation, manufacturing, energy, and private equity firms.

Caroline is a Board member of Oxil, a cloud-based IT business, and Tax & Super Australia, a 100-year old member organisation. She is also a Director of Bangay Capital Pty Ltd, a consulting firm.

She is a graduate of the Australian Institute of Superannuation (GAIST) and is a member of the Australian Institute of Company Directors (MAICD).

Caroline holds a Masters of Business Administration (MBA) from Melbourne Business School and a Bachelor of Economics (Hons.) from Monash University.
